Shenandoah Valley Hot Air Balloon & Wine Festival
What has beautiful scenery, hot air balloons and wine? The Shenandoah Valley Hot Air Balloon & Wine Festival in Virginia. Last year Terry and I found this festival by accident, as we do with most things. We enjoy the Shenandoah area, hiking, horseback and motorcycle riding and camping. We especially enjoy the mountain views. The festival is held at Historic Long Branch, a mansion sitting on 400 acres of hilly countrytside. As well as host to the festival, Long Branch is home to R.E.A.C.H., the Regional Equine Associates Central Hospital. The hospital provides medical and retirement services to horses.
Friday night features a balloon glow. If you want to see the balloons go up you have to be there early. Dress warm! After the balloons go up enjoy the many vendors and large variety of foods, live music, car displays and don’t forget the wine tasting. This year Terry and I attended the festiival with the First State Corvette Club members and displayed our car. There are also barn tours and activities for the kids. Unfortunately, the one thing you won’t find is horseback riding. But, many horses can be see from the hillside. If you have never seen the balloons up close, this festival provides a very enjoyable day. And don’t forget the wine! www.historiclongbranch.com/balloonfest/
